Senior figures at Liverpool are reportedly gathering in Boston today for what is being described as a hugely important meeting regarding the future direction of the club.
According to reports, key members of the Liverpool hierarchy and senior officials will discuss a wide range of major issues ahead of a crucial summer at Anfield.
Among the topics expected to be discussed are contract situations, the head coach position, transfer plans and the overall long-term structure of the club moving forward.
The timing of the meeting is significant.
Liverpool are coming towards the end of one of the club’s most disappointing seasons in modern Premier League history, with pressure growing around Arne Slot, squad planning and the overall direction under the ownership of Fenway Sports Group.
Supporters have become increasingly frustrated in recent months as performances declined, defensive problems worsened and uncertainty continued to surround several key players and contracts.
Reports suggest discussions around the manager’s future will form part of the talks.
While public briefings have continued to back Slot, speculation surrounding his long-term future has not disappeared following Liverpool’s collapse this season.
There are also major concerns surrounding contracts and squad planning, with several senior players either approaching the final stages of their deals or facing uncertain futures at the club.
